Mechanism of Action
This ingredient operates through its potent antioxidant and anti-inflammatory properties, attributed to phenolic compounds, flavonoid glycosides, and vitamins A, C, and E, which effectively scavenge superoxide and hydroxyl radicals to mitigate cellular damage and reduce erythema. It actively stimulates dermal fibroblasts to boost collagen synthesis and exhibits anti-elastase activity, crucial for maintaining skin elasticity. Specific fatty acids, including oleic and linoleic acid, are believed to inhibit the α-1 reductase enzyme, thereby decreasing sebum output. Its natural sugars and amino acids support cell regeneration and reinforce the skin's protective barrier, preventing trans-epidermal moisture loss, while polyphenols and flavonoids contribute antimicrobial benefits.

Clinical Evidence
High confidence4%
Key findings
- 01 In an 8-week clinical study, a 4% concentration in a cream formulation significantly improved skin elasticity, reduced pigmentation, redness, and sebum, while boosting overall brightness and hydration. It notably increased skin moisture and elasticity and decreased melanin and erythema, with no observed adverse reactions.
- 02 When incorporated into a peel-off gel mask, a 2% concentration effectively increased facial skin moisture content and demonstrated no irritation.

Formulation
Stability
The ingredient is water-soluble or dispersible in polar solvents, compatible with its rich composition of sugars, vitamins, and phenolic compounds. It has been successfully formulated into creams, peel-off gel masks, and hydrogels, demonstrating good stability over several months. It can also contribute to the stability of emulsions at high temperatures.

Safety Profile
Phoenix Dactylifera Fruit Powder is generally considered safe for topical cosmetic application. Official studies, including patch tests, indicate a very low incidence of allergic reactions or irritation, making it suitable for most skin types. Public health authorities and cosmetic regulations typically recognize date palm extracts as safe and effective.
